Mark 7:10-12
New American Standard Bible
Chapter 7
10For Moses said, ‘HONOR YOUR FATHER AND YOUR MOTHER’; and, ‘THE ONE WHO SPEAKS EVIL OF FATHER OR MOTHER, IS CERTAINLY TO BE PUT TO DEATH’; 11but you say, ‘If a person says to his father or his mother, whatever I have that would help you is Corban (that is, given to God),’ 12you no longer allow him to do anything for his father or his mother;King James Version
